BIDDEFORD - On July 2, 1989, Pamela Webb's 1981 Chevrolet pickup truck was found abandoned on the Maine Turnpike at mile 30.4 southbound in Biddeford.

The passenger side rear tire was flat and a spare tire was leaning against the tailgate. There were blood stains on the pavement on the passenger side of the truck. Pamela’s dog was in the front of the truck. A turnpike ticket was found inside the truck indicating Webb entered the turnpike in Augusta at 9:52 pm on July 1. Pamela was headed to Mason, NH, to visit her boyfriend who reported her missing at 10 a.m. on July 2nd.

Sixteen days later, on July 18, Pamela’s body was found in Franconia, NH.
